What is the economic situation in Bangladesh?

Bangladesh, a country located in South Asia, has experienced significant economic growth over the past few decades. As one of the fastest-growing economies in the world, it has managed to transform itself from a low-income country to a lower-middle-income country. This article aims to provide an overview of the current economic situation in Bangladesh, highlighting its strengths, challenges, and future prospects.

Economic Growth and Key Sectors

The economic situation in Bangladesh has been characterized by robust growth, driven primarily by the agriculture, ready-made garments (RMG), and remittances sectors. Agriculture remains the backbone of the economy, employing a significant portion of the population and contributing to about 20% of the GDP. The RMG sector, which has become the largest export earner for the country, contributes around 80% of the total export earnings. Moreover, remittances from Bangladeshis working abroad have been a crucial source of foreign exchange, accounting for about 10% of the GDP.

Challenges and Concerns

Despite the impressive growth, Bangladesh faces several challenges that could potentially impact its economic situation. One of the most pressing concerns is the issue of climate change, which poses a significant threat to the country’s agricultural productivity and overall economic stability. Additionally, the country’s infrastructure, particularly in transportation and energy, needs substantial improvement to support continued economic growth. Moreover, the rapid urbanization and population growth have put pressure on the country’s resources and environmental sustainability.

Future Prospects

Looking ahead, Bangladesh has the potential to achieve even greater economic success. The government has been implementing various policies and initiatives to address the challenges and promote sustainable growth. These include investing in infrastructure development, improving education and healthcare, and enhancing the business environment. Moreover, the country’s strategic location in the Bay of Bengal and its growing middle class present opportunities for further economic expansion.
